虚拟现实(Virtual Reality,简称VR)技术是一种通过计算机技术模拟构建的虚拟环境,用户可以通过特殊的设备(如VR头盔)进入这个环境,与之进行互动。今天,我们就来揭秘一下VR技术中点阵构成虚拟世界,以及VR渲染背后的奥秘。
一、点阵:虚拟世界的基石
在VR技术中,点阵是构成虚拟世界的基本单元。点阵(Pixel)是像素的简称,它是组成图像的最小单位。在VR世界中,每个点阵都代表着现实世界中一个微小的空间区域。
1. 点阵的生成
点阵的生成是通过计算机图形学中的三维建模和渲染技术实现的。首先,我们需要创建一个三维模型,然后将这个模型分解成无数个点阵。每个点阵都包含了该点阵在三维空间中的位置信息、颜色信息以及纹理信息。
2. 点阵的渲染
在VR设备中,点阵经过渲染处理后,最终呈现在用户眼前。渲染过程包括以下步骤:
- 着色:根据点阵的位置信息、颜色信息和纹理信息,计算每个点阵的最终颜色。
- 投影:将三维空间中的点阵投影到二维屏幕上。
- 抗锯齿:对投影后的图像进行处理,消除锯齿状边缘,使图像更加平滑。
二、VR渲染背后的奥秘
VR渲染技术是VR技术中的关键环节,它决定了虚拟世界的真实感和沉浸感。以下是VR渲染背后的几个奥秘:
1. 高性能计算
VR渲染需要大量的计算资源,包括CPU、GPU和内存。为了实现流畅的渲染效果,需要使用高性能的硬件设备。
2. 优化算法
VR渲染过程中,需要采用各种优化算法,如空间划分、光线追踪、动态着色等,以提高渲染效率。
3. 适应不同场景
VR渲染需要适应不同的场景,如室内、室外、城市、森林等。为了实现这一点,需要收集大量的场景数据,并利用计算机图形学技术进行处理。
4. 交互性
VR渲染不仅要实现视觉效果,还要实现交互性。这意味着渲染过程中需要考虑用户在虚拟世界中的移动、旋转、缩放等操作,并实时更新渲染结果。
三、总结
点阵是构成虚拟世界的基本单元,VR渲染技术是实现虚拟现实的关键。通过点阵的生成和渲染,我们可以进入一个全新的虚拟世界,体验前所未有的沉浸感。随着VR技术的不断发展,未来我们将能够体验到更加真实、丰富的虚拟世界。
